【Kyoto Prize Commemorative Lecture】Bruno Latour “How to React to a Change in Cosmology”
This is the Commemorative Lecture “How to React to a Change in Cosmology” (about 23 minutes) by Bruno Latour, a Philosopher who received the 2021 Kyoto Prize Laureate in Arts and Philosophy.
The Kyoto Prize is an international award of Japanese origin, presented to individuals who have made significant contributions in the fields of science and technology, as well as the arts and philosophy.
This year, in order to prevent the spread of COVID-19, the Presentation Ceremony and other related events have been cancelled. Instead, videos of the Commemorative Lectures will be presented online with the aim of disseminating the achievements and ideas of the laureates to many people.
